EPA Drops Key NSR Suit To Avoid Adverse Precedent On Injunctive Relief

August 13, 2019
EPA and the Sierra Club have dropped their long-running suit against Texas utility Luminant for violations of new source review (NSR) permitting requirements in an effort to avoid a broad adverse precedent that could hamstring future actions to seek injunctive relief for past violations under multiple statutes across a wide swath of the country.
